Ingredients

Scale
  • 45 Bone-In Chicken Thighs
  • 2 tsp Onion Powder
  • 2 tsp Garlic Powder
  • 1 tsp Smoked Paprika
  • 1 tsp Fresh Thyme
  • 2 tbsps Fresh Rosemary, chopped
  • 1 Red Onion, sliced
  • 12 Honeycrisp Apples, sliced
  • 4 tbsps Salted Butter
  • 3/4 cup Apple Cider
  • 1/2 cup Chicken Broth or White Grape Juice
  • 2 tbsps Dijon Mustard
  • 3 cloves Garlic
  • Olive oil
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. Season chicken thighs with onion powder, garlic powder, smoked paprika, thyme, salt, and pepper.
  3. Heat olive oil in an o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at; sear chicken thighs skin-side down until golden brown.
  4. Add sliced red onions and Honeycrisp apples around the chicken in the pan.
  5. Transfer the skillet to the oven and bake for about 20-25 minutes until ch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
  6. For the sauce, combine butter, apple cider, broth (or grape juice), Dijon mustard, and minced garlic in the same skillet over medium heat; whisk until thickened.
  7. Return chicken and apples to the pan; spoon sauce over before serving.
